Diploma holders in business management in Kenya possess versatile skills that open doors to diverse career opportunities across various sectors. They can pursue roles as business administrators, office managers, or administrative assistants, where they oversee daily operations, manage resources, and ensure efficient workflow within organizations.
Additionally, graduates may find employment in roles such as marketing assistants, sales representatives, or customer service supervisors, contributing to business growth through strategic marketing initiatives and effective client engagement.
Opportunities also exist in human resource management, where diploma holders can work as HR assistants, recruitment coordinators, or training facilitators, supporting employee development and organizational success. With further training and experience, diploma holders can advance to positions such as business development managers, operations supervisors, or project coordinators, overseeing strategic initiatives and driving business growth.
